The Emerson A6370D/DP is a high-performance industrial display specifically engineered for use with DeltaV operator workstations. It provides a reliable and clear interface for process operators to monitor and interact with control systems, whether in a central control room or an on-site equipment room.
The A6370D/DP features a 17-inch TFT active matrix LCD with 1280 x 1024 (SXGA) resolution and 16.7 million colors, delivering crisp text and detailed graphics. The DP variant includes a resistive touch screen that responds to gloved hand or stylus input, making it suitable for industrial environments where operators may wear protective gear. The display offers wide viewing angles (160° horizontal/140° vertical) and a brightness of 300 cd/m² with automatic backlight dimming.

Housed in a rugged sheet-metal chassis with a NEMA 4X / IP66-rated bezel, the A6370D/DP resists dust, water jets, and corrosive agents. It operates reliably in temperatures from 0°C to 50°C and can withstand shock and vibration per IEC 60068-2 standards. The display supports panel mounting or VESA arm attachment, offering flexible installation options.
The unit provides VGA and DVI-D inputs, ensuring compatibility with DeltaV workstations and standard PCs. It also features USB ports for touch screen interface and downstream peripherals. The A6370D/DP includes on-screen display (OSD) controls for brightness, contrast, and geometry adjustment, which can be locked to prevent unauthorized changes.
This display is ideal for continuous monitoring of process graphics, alarm summaries, and trend charts in industries such as oil and gas, chemical processing, and power generation. Its touch capability allows operators to navigate screens quickly, acknowledge alarms, and adjust setpoints directly.
Designed for long service life, the A6370D/DP has a backlight half-life of 50,000 hours. It meets FCC Class A, CE, and UL 60950-1 safety standards, ensuring electromagnetic compatibility and operator safety.
